West Main Intermediate Elementary School (Closed 2008)

112 W Main St
Newark, OH 43055
West Main Intermediate Elementary School serves 432 students in grades 5-6. 
The student-teacher ratio of 16:1 was lower than the Ohio state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ment was 8% of the student body (majority Black), which was lower than the Ohio state average of 34% (majority Black).
